Kane bought a bag of taffy at the candy store. He got 10 vanilla for his mom, 15 chocolate for his dad, 6 licorice for his sister, and 22 peppermint for himself. On the way home, Kane's sister grabbed a piece out of the sack without looking. What are the chances that she pulled out a licorice piece?

P(she pulled out a licorice piece) = 6/(10 + 15 + 6 + 22)


P(she pulled out a licorice piece) = 6/53


P(she pulled out a licorice piece) = 0.1132
